Invitation for Bids
The Lao People’s Democratic Republic has received financing from the Asian Development Bank toward the cost of the Vientiane Sustainable Urban Transport Project (VSUTP) and intends to apply part of the proceeds toward payments under the contract named above. Bidding is open to Bidders from eligible source countries of ADB.
The Department of Transport (DOT) of the Ministry of Public Work and Transport, (MPWT) Lao PDR (the “Employer”) invites sealed bids from eligible Bidders for the Supply and Installation of Automatic Fare Collection (AFC) System for the Vientiane BRT (the “Goods”). Details and specifications are provided in the specified in Section 6 (Schedule of Supply) of the Bidding Documents. Completion period is within two (2) years from the date of approval of the system by the Employer. The Bid is for ONE complete Lot and for the related services..
International Competitive Bidding will be conducted in accordance with ADB’s Single- Stage: One-Envelope bidding procedure and is open to all Bidders from eligible countries as described in the Bidding Document.
